首页
学习
活动
专区
圈层
工具
发布

Google Earth Engine(GEE)—有JS和python为什么GEE还要使用rgee?

与平台交互的方式有以下几种: discover 代码编辑器 Javascript 客户端库 Python客户端库 R 客户端库 本网站重点介绍最后一个,您可以使用 R 客户端库向地球引擎服务器和开发Web...WEB REST API/客户端库:用于向地球引擎服务器发出请求。 代码编辑器:一个在线集成开发环境 (IDE),用于使用 Javascript API 对复杂空间分析进行快速原型设计和可视化。...内置身份验证 对 R 用户更友好的 I/O API。 有限的输入/输出功能 许多绘图选项 无法与其他 JS 库集成 需要一些rgee(和维护)! 6....这些变量将被用于定义网状环境变量RETICULATE_PYTHON加载rgee时。 安装 rgee Python 依赖项:Earth Engine Python API和 Numpy。...考虑到您设置的 Python Environment 必须安装了Earth Engine Python API和Numpy。

1.4K10

在 Linux 命令行中收发 Gmail 邮件

安装 Mutt 在 Linux 系统上,一般可以直接从发行版提供的软件库中安装 Mutt,另外需要在家目录中创建一个 .mutt 目录以存放配置文件: $ sudo dnf install mutt $...我们需要 OfflineIMAP 这个 Python 应用程序来实现 IMAP 的集成,这个应用程序可以在 它的 GitHub 存储库 获取。...OfflineIMAP 目前仍然在从 Python 2 移植到 Python 3,目前需要手动安装,但以后你也可以通过 python3 -m pip 命令进行安装。...OfflineIMAP 依赖于 imaplib2 库,这个库也在努力开发当中,所以我更喜欢手动安装。同样地,也是通过 Git 将代码库克隆到本地,进入目录后使用 pip 安装。...在 Google 生成密码之后,将其替换 .offlineimaprc 配置文件中的 %your-gmail-API-password% 值。

3.9K20
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    Google Earth Engine(GEE)-谷歌地球引擎的大致Python入门

    它通过一个可访问互联网的应用程序编程接口(API)和一个相关的基于web的交互式开发环境(IDE)进行访问和控制,该环境支持快速原型和结果可视化。...用户可以使用Earth Engine API提供的操作员库访问和分析公共目录中的数据以及自己的私有数据。这些运算符在一个大型并行处理系统中实现,该系统自动细分和分配计算,提供高吞吐量分析功能。...4、GEE的两种Python编译手段(线上和线下): 05 如果你家的网络好,可以访问国外网站,我还是建议安一个线下的,但是由于我这无法访问国外网站,还是乖乖运行Google Colab进行线上编译吧,...直接选择箭头,如果你没有这个,就去关联更多应用中搜索google colaboratory,点击安装就能写python啦。...界面是这样(新建的是ipynb): 06 安装第三方库使用的是pip方法,在pip之前输入!就好了。 import ee print(ee.__version__) !

    7.5K44

    python简介

    Python是一种开源的面向对象编程语言 随着人工智能与大数据分析的火热,python也随之火热起来 Python应用广泛,特别适用以下几个方面 1.系统编程:提供API(Application Programming...数据库编程:程序员可通过遵循 Python DB-API(数据库应用程序编程接口)规范的模块与Microsoft SQL Server,Oracle,Sybase,DB2,Mysql,SQLite等数据库通信....Python自带有一个Gadfly模块,提供了一个完整的SQL环境. 6.网络编程:提供丰富的模块支持sockets编程,能方便快速地开发分布式应用程序,很多大规模软件开发计划,例如Zope,Mnet...4.Django:鼓励快速开发的Web应用框架 5.Fabric:用于管理成百上千台linux主机的程序库 6.EVE:网络游戏EVE大量使用Python进行开发 7.Blender:以C与Python...Groups,Gmail,Google Maps等,Google App Engine支持python作为开发语言 14.NASA:美国宇航局,从1994年起把python作为主要开发语言 15.Industrial

    86120

    简单粗暴上手TensorFlow 2.0,北大学霸力作,必须人手一册!

    这本手册是 Google Summer of Code 2019 项目之一,从基础安装与环境配置、部署,到大规模训练与加速、扩展,全方位讲解 TensorFlow 2.0 的入门要点,并附录相关资料供读者参考...这是一本简明的 TensorFlow 2.0 入门指导手册,基于 Keras 和 Eager Execution(即时运行)模式,力图让具备一定机器学习及 Python 基础的开发者们快速上手 TensorFlow...前言 此前,TensorFlow 所基于的传统 Graph Execution 的弊端,如入门门槛高、调试困难、灵活性差、无法使用 Python 原生控制语句等早已被开发者诟病许久。...基础 TensorFlow 安装与环境配置 TensorFlow 的最新安装步骤可参考官方网站上的说明(https://tensorflow.google.cn/install)。...基础使用 在 Swift 中使用标准的 TensorFlow API 在 Swift 中直接加载 Python 语言库 语言原生支持自动微分 MNIST 数字分类 TensorFlow in Julia

    1.6K40

    Python yagmail库教程:轻松发送电子邮件 - Python邮件发送指南

    yagmail是一个专为Python设计的邮件发送库,它简化了通过SMTP发送邮件的复杂过程。与Python内置的smtplib相比,yagmail提供了更简洁、更Pythonic的API。...主要优点:极简的API设计,减少代码量自动处理SMTP连接支持HTML内容和附件安全存储密码支持Gmail及其他SMTP服务安装yagmail使用pip安装:pip install yagmail基本用法...发送简单文本邮件import yagmail# 初始化客户端(首次使用会提示输入密码)yag = yagmail.SMTP('your_email@gmail.com', host='smtp.gmail.com...如何解决Gmail发送问题?确保在Google账户中启用了"安全性较低的应用的访问权限"或使用应用专用密码。2. 支持哪些邮件服务商?...yagmail支持所有SMTP服务,包括:Gmail: smtp.gmail.com, 端口465/587Outlook/Hotmail: smtp-mail.outlook.com, 端口587Yahoo

    39210

    MCP的新特性——代码执行.

    如果您希望快速上手MCP,可以参考本人的《MCP极简入门》一书—— MCP 代码执行特性使LLM能够在沙箱中编写并运行 Python/JavaScript 代码,将工具能力转化为可导入的代码模块,而非依赖前端的预定义...你查看“Google Drive”和“Gmail”类目,走到对应书架,仅取出需要的两本书,其余 88 本仍安静地留在原位。.../servers'); // 返回:['google-drive', 'gmail', 'salesforce', 'slack'] Agent 判断:“我需要 Google Drive 获取文档,Gmail...', // 经 MCP 客户端标记化 phone: '[PHONE_0]', // 真实值被替换 company: 'Acme Corp' } MCP 客户端维护私有查询表,在数据需要发送至...即使 LLM 尝试查看,也始终无法获取原始信息。

    26810

    基于实时反向代理的Gmail钓鱼攻击机制与防御对策研究

    通知抑制:在代理响应中注入脚本,拦截Google的推送通知API调用:// 注入到Google页面的JS(通过onProxyReq修改HTML)window.Notification = {requestPermission...客户端(需攻击者自有Google Cloud项目);发起授权请求并自动批准;提取refresh_token存档。...“敏感API访问审核”,对Gmail、Drive等高危权限实施审批制。...:仅允许注册设备访问Gmail;要求设备满足加密、OS版本、EDR安装等基线;对非合规设备强制执行MFA+安全密钥。...攻击者域名(如google-security-alert.com)即使使用HTTPS,也无法获得Google官方证书。6 结论基于实时反向代理的Gmail钓鱼攻击代表了身份安全威胁的新阶段。

    21510

    MCP 全解析:AI Agent 如何突破“工具困境”?一文带你掌握核心协议与实战部署指南

    ,1对1连接Server MCP Server 暴露功能能力的Server,比如调用浏览器、读写文件等 Local Data Source 本地文件、服务或数据库 Remote Services Gmail...举例:Google Calendar 场景 当你说「下周和 Alice 的会议都改期」时,如果直接让模型调用 Calendar API,可能会误修改其他日程。...如何快速部署 MCP Server?连接 100+ 工具只需几步 使用场景:在 Cursor 中启用 MCP,实现 Gmail、Slack、YouTube 等服务连接。...Composio 支持 TypeScript、Python、Cursor、Claude、Windsurf 等客户端。...Step 4:使用 npx 命令安装并配置 Server 以 Gmail 为例,生成如下命令: npx @composio/mcp@latest setup "https://mcp.composio.dev

    2.4K10

    tensorflow学习笔记_01

    目前被50个团队用于研究和生产许多Google商业产品,如语音识别、Gmail、Google 相册和搜索,其中许多产品曾使用过其前任软件DistBelief。...这个库的算法源于Google需要指导称为神经网络的计算机系统,类似人类学习和推理的方法,以便派生出新的应用程序承担以前仅人类能胜任的角色和职能;TensorFlow的名字来源于这类神经网络对多维数组执行的操作...tensorflow安装 安装过程很简单,就是普通的python库安装方法,这里重点说一下windows下安装tensorflow的方法,玩其它系统的用户看看官方文档肯定能搞定安装。...安装64位3.5.x版的python,安装包从这里下载 安装cpu版本或gpu版本(如果有NV的显卡的话)的tensorflow 1 C:\> pip3 install --upgrade tensorflow.../python

    83770

    Python资料推荐 + IDE推荐+经典练手项目(开源免费)

    学习资料 1、入门阶段 The Python TutorialPython guan官方文档,永远是最佳选择 Google's Python Class Google的文档,质量相当高 Python3...教程 | 菜鸟教程 如果英文不好,可以参考国内教程 Learn Python the Hard Way 最简单的学习 Python 的方法, HTML 在线版是完全免费的 零基础入门学习Python 网易云课堂...博客里面包含了很多python library的知识 知乎 - 与世界分享你的知识、经验和见解 隐藏着各种Python大神 经典入门及第三方库 vinta/awesome-python 精心设计的Python...展示高分辨率地图 charlierguo/gmail Google Mail的Pythonic界面 egirault/googleplay-api Google Play非官方的Python API...它是基于服务器 - 客户端结构的Web应用程序,它允许您创建和操作笔记本文档 - 或只是“笔记本”。

    3K12

    AutoML – 用于构建机器学习模型的无代码解决方案

    AutoML还提供Python和其他编程语言的客户端库 支持的数据类型 AutoML 支持非结构化和结构化数据,分为四种类型 图像 表格 视频 文本 使用这四种数据类型,你可以执行 AutoML 支持的某些活动...帐户设置是一个非常简单的过程,只需转到 URL https://console.cloud.google.com/并单击“加入”,它会要求你提供 Gmail 电子邮件 ID 和密码,然后就会在 GCP...Python 中的 AutoML 客户端库 我们将使用 Python 中的 AutoML 客户端库为演示创建表格分类模型。 首先,你需要安装这两个软件包。 !...pip install --upgrade google-cloud-storage 成功安装这两个包后,重新启动内核。...本文的主要要点是: 如何借助 AutoML 客户端库以编程方式利用 AutoML 服务 你可以在 AutoML 中构建不同类型的模型,例如图像分类、文本实体提取、时间序列预测、对象检测等 你不需要太多的

    1.9K20

    年底总结一下Python WEB最好用的几个框架,让你有一个系统的了解

    2017年就要过完了,我们来总结一下2017年最好用的17个Python Web框架 群内不定时分享干货,包括2017最新的python企业案例学习资料和零基础入门教程,欢迎初学和进阶中的小伙伴入群学习交流...Hug Python最快的Web框架之一。它旨在构建API。它支持提供几个API版本,自动API文档和注释验证。此外,Hug是建立在另一个名为Falcon的JSON框架之上的。...其功能包括具有真正的多数据库支持的ORM,支持水平数据分区,小部件系统以简化AJAX应用程序的开发。模板引擎是Kajiki(必须另外安装)。...Reahl 用纯Python开发Web应用程序的Web框架。有一些小部件可以在通常的Python代码中使用,定制和编写。这些小部件描述了特定的服务器端和客户端行为。...尝试Pyramid,如果你发展丰富但非凡的东西可以尝试尝试Pyramid 由于框架的选择取决于项目的特定需求,因此我们无法挑选出最适合网络开发的Python框架。

    3.8K80

    使用CredSniper窃取红队行动中的2FA令牌

    API集成CredSniper提供轻量级API,支持快速消费易过期的2FA令牌。API功能包括:查看凭证(GET):https:///creds/view?...api_token=API令牌>更新配置(POST):https:///configundefined请求体示例:{ "enable_2fa": true, "module": "gmail...", "api_token": "随机字符串"}简易安装克隆仓库: $ git clone https://github.com/ustayready/CredSniper$ cd CredSniper...依赖安装:自动安装Python3、VirtualEnv、CertBot等组件。安装后运行python credsniper.py --help即可启动。...以Gmail为例,认证流程分三阶段:邮箱验证:加载用户头像(通过Google Picaso服务)密码验证:后台验证并检测2FA状态2FA令牌捕获:根据类型(短信/OTP/Yubikey)处理总结CredSniper

    21910
    领券